Bradfield is a registered, family owned and run residential home established in 1995. They care for up to 37 people offering both full time residential stay and day care facilities. Bradfield is registered with the Care Quality Commission and achieved an Outstanding rating in December 2015.

The aims for Bradfield are to maintain a homely environment for older people which respects their privacy, dignity and personal esteem.

-To offer each resident a better quality of life, responding to their individual needs and tailoring services to meet their choices wherever possible.

-To follow best practice in housing management and care.

-To provide accommodation and facilities of a high standard.

The objectives for Bradfield

Bradfield strives to offer fair and equal treatment to all, regardless of age, sex, marital status, sexual orientation, race, colour, nationality, ethic origin, disability, religious belief or financial circumstances.

There are two managers who run Bradfield on a daily basis. They are supported by an assistant manager, duty manager and an excellent team of four senior carers, 20 trained carers, five chefs and six domestic staff to uphold the aims and objectives of the home. Knowledge and experience are essential in this field of work.

The staff are responsible for meeting the individual needs of each resident as set out in their plan of care. To do this, trained members of caring staff are on duty 24 hours a day, one of which includes a senior carer. The proprietors are the management team and are on duty during the day and on call at night, and live on the premises.

They understand that moving into a caring environment is a big decision and they strive to help each resident maintain their chosen lifestyle whilst becoming part of a community.

  • Care fees at Bradfield are all inclusive, with the exception of standard charges such as Hairdressing, Chiropody, Newspapers and private telephone.
    Transport and chaperone service is included for all local medical appointments for example GP, hospital, dentist etc.
    Bradfield also has a wheelchair adapted vehicle which can be loaned free of charge to friends and relatives.
    Bradfield does not charge additional fees if a residents care needs change.

The Review Score of 9.8 (9.846) out of 10 for Bradfield Residential Home is based on a) the Average Rating and b) the number of positive Reviews.

  • a) The Average Rating is 4.8 out of 5 from 41 Reviews in the last 24 months.

  • b) The score for the number of positive Reviews is 5.0 out of 5 from 41 positive Reviews in the last 24 months.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  • a) 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months.

    The Average Rating of 4.846 for Bradfield Residential Home is calculated as follows: ( (421 Excellents x 5) + (55 Goods x 4) + (10 Satisfactorys x 3) ) ÷ 486 Ratings = 4.846

  • b) 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5').

    The 5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Bradfield Residential Home is based on 41 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    • i) 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 = 4

    • ii) 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 37 registered maximum number of service users is 7.4, which has been reached with 41 Positive reviews. Points = 1

  • When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.

  • If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
